Funding: Year One Progress

Learn about our progress in funding early childhood care, including cost analysis, grants, and the creation of a new dedicated fund.

Accomplishments

Develop a plan to transition to funding based on the cost of care starting with infant and toddler care and high need communities.

  • Completed cost analysis

Develop a flexible fiscal model to support implementation and help to prioritize and stage investments in alignment with system reforms.

  • Awarded facilities grants to high SVI providers – $13M to date: $10M in new state bonding
  • Funding partnership with CDFI and CHEFA

Identify new dedicated funding streams to support sustained and significant public and private incremental investment in ECE.

  • Early Childhood Care and Education Fund established in legislation
  • Designated members to the Early Childhood Care and Education Fund Advisory Commission
